ページの先頭行へ戻る
Enterprise Postgres 14 SP1 スケールアウト運用ガイド
FUJITSU Software

3.5.3 ストリーミングレプリケーションの状態確認

“クラスタ運用ガイド(データベース多重化編)”の“ストリーミングレプリケーションの状態確認”を参照し、ストリーミングレプリケーションの状態確認を行ってください。ただし、fetch_slotsパラメータにonが設定されている場合、プライマリサーバにおいて統計情報ビューpg_stat_replicationにより検索できる行数は2行になります。

psqlコマンドを使用した場合の出力例を以下に示します。

postgres=# select * from pg_stat_replication;
-[ RECORD 1 ]----+------------------------------
pid              | 2678454
usesysid         | 10
usename          | fsep
application_name | standby
client_addr      | 192.168.3.142
client_hostname  |
client_port      | 48662
backend_start    | 2022-06-14 08:57:01.340282+09
backend_xmin     |
state            | startup
sent_lsn         |
write_lsn        |
flush_lsn        |
replay_lsn       |
write_lag        |
flush_lag        |
replay_lag       |
sync_priority    | 0
sync_state       | async
reply_time       |
-[ RECORD 2 ]----+------------------------------
pid              | 2678455
usesysid         | 10
usename          | fsep
application_name | standby
client_addr      | 192.168.3.142
client_hostname  |
client_port      | 48664
backend_start    | 2022-06-14 08:57:01.35178+09
backend_xmin     |
state            | streaming
sent_lsn         | 0/150038D8
write_lsn        | 0/150038D8
flush_lsn        | 0/150038D8
replay_lsn       | 0/150038D8
write_lag        | 00:00:00.00215
flush_lag        | 00:00:00.00215
replay_lag       | 00:00:00.00215
sync_priority    | 1
sync_state       | sync
reply_time       | 2022-06-14 08:56:52.74245+09